What is the curd?
Fruit curd is a kind of cream/topping based on eggs, made from different fruits.
Typically, this cream is made from citrus fruits – lemons, limes, oranges, tangerines, but it also can be made from berries (blueberries, raspberries, blackberries), or tropical fruits like mango, papaya, passion fruit, or a mix of fruits.

The origin of this cream is English and appeared in the 19th century, being used as an alternative to jams served with scones.
Uses:
It can be used as such, or in different cakes, tarts, no-bake cheesecakes, pancakes, muffins, and ice creams, but also spread on bread with butter. That’s why it falls under the category of spreads.

How and for how long, do we preserve the curd?
- In vacuum: 3 weeks at +4 degrees.
- In the freezer: 3/4 months at -18 degrees.
- In an airtight container in the fridge: 7-10 days.
INGREDIENTS:

- The juice from 6 limes (220 ml)
- The zest of the limes
- 3 passion fruits
- 80 g Stevia
- 4 egg yolks + 1 whole egg
- 70 g butter (80%)
- Pinch of salt.

INSTRUCTIONS for this perfumed lime and passion fruit curd:
1. Grate the zest from the limes (preferably organic), then squeeze them.
2, Put the zest and lime juice in a small saucepan with the passion fruit seeds, the egg yolks, the whole egg, the Stevia sweetener, and the salt, then put them on the fire on low-medium fire and let it boil. Boil the cream until it starts to thicken, about 2-3 minutes.


3. During this time I mixed continuously until the composition became a thick cream, like a pudding. I took it off the heat, let it cool for 2 minutes, then incorporated the butter until smooth.

4. Strain the cream obtained so that no traces of lime zest or any lumps remain

5. Place a clean foil film on top to prevent a crust from forming and leave the dessert to cool.
6. After it has cooled, cover the jar with the lid and refrigerate the dessert until use.
I obtained a delicious, aromatic, fine lime and passion fruit curd. Now the cream is liquid, but it thickens more by staying in the fridge (obligatory!).Â
The melted butter in it will solidify in the cold! Refrigerate for a few hours. Moreover, the curd can be kept in the refrigerator for 7-10 days.
